A feminine noun is almost always used with feminine articles and adjectives (e.g. la mujer bonita, la luna llena).
feminine noun
1. (animal anatomy)
a. horns (plural)
El toro hirió al torero con su enorme cornamenta.The bull wounded the bullfighter with its huge horns.
b. antlers (plural)
Había cornamentas de venados decorando las paredes de la cabaña.There were deer antlers decorating the walls of the cabin.
